How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Senior Design Engineer

    The Role 

    Lead the Engineering department and provide support to Operations as well as ensuring that the Company considers and applies, where applicable, latest engineering techniques and technology.           

    Senior Design Engineer 

    Main Responsibilities 

    •Target, manage, motivate and evaluate the performance of all direct reports. To take remedial action as agreed. To inform HR of any training needs.

    •Ensure the team delivers innovative designs/solutions from concept through to production within the agreed budgetary controls and timeframes.

    •Ensure that the Company produces products and designs to the highest standard of quality including all safety critical items being adequately checked and controlled.

    •Ensure the Company is fully aware (and utilises where possible) of new manufacturing technology and techniques both within existing and new products. Liaise with the Manufacturing Teams to implement new and improved methods.

    •Ensure that existing products are further developed by the team to enhance functionality, ease of manufacture/assembly/cost out.

    •Regularly review the full Company product range and make recommendations to the Exec/Sales Team regarding rationalisation.

    •Investigate, validate, authorise and communicate effectively engineering changes and new product releases to all relevant teams.

    •Control and monitor the R&D budget to ensure spend is effective and within agreed limits.

    •Ensure that the Company is fully compliant with new and upcoming statutory requirements, recommend changes to the Operations Manager/Managing Director regarding technical aspects of the markets served.

    •Investigate available sources of funding and opportunities within the industry.

    •Act as the Company’s technical representative/expert witness as required.

    •Oversee the Quality Systems and Policies ensuring compliance, checks and controls.

    •Ensure that any customer complaints regarding design or quality are fully and professionally investigated and followed up appropriately.

    •Provide a professional and accurate advice to all customers when answering technical questions.

    •Lead large complex projects and where necessary, work with the senior team to produce capital investment proposals to enable said projects.

    •Help solve production design problems and help with any difficulty the production staff may have and look for ways to ease problems.

    •Provide support for Sales/Commercial and liaise with the Purchasing Department.

    •Any other duties deemed reasonable on request.           

    Senior Design Engineer 

    The Candidate 

    •Experience within an Engineering Design department covering structures / Chassis design and components (Vehicle Transport sector preferred).

    •In depth Engineering knowledge covering an understanding of stress analysis and Metallurgical / Metallurgy.

    •Management of a small team of designers and workshop staff for prototype production and jig manufacture.

    •Experience of shop floor interaction to implement changes to design and improve efficiencies and product features.

    •Requirements for occasional customer visits to discuss product technical issues and new product development opportunities.

    •Good working knowledge of costing systems/BOM creation and drawing controls.

    •Degree qualified BSc/HND Mechanical Engineering.

    •Experience of Quality systems and procedures.
